FxOpen is reg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) in the UK, the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C), and the Financial Services Authority (FSA) in Seychelles. Alpari is regulated by the Financial Services Commission (FSC) in Mauritius and CySEC. Neither broker is regulated by the local financial regulator in Jordan, which is typical for international brokers serving Jordanian clients. For Jordan traders, FxOpen’s FCA regulation provides a higher level of investor protection, including negative balance protection and access to the Financial Ombudsman Service. Alpari’s regulation is less stringent but still meets international standards. Jordan traders should be aware that deposits are not protected by a local compensation scheme, so choosing a broker with strong regulation is advisable.

Both FxOpen and Alpari off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Jordan’s Muslim traders. These accounts comply with Sharia law by eliminating swap or rollover interest on positions held overnight. FxOpen provides Islamic accounts on all account types, including ECN, with no extra fees. Alpari also offers swap-free accounts, but they may not be available on all account types and may have restrictions on certain instruments. For Jordan traders, both options are viable, but FxOpen’s broader availability and transparent policy make it slightly more favorable. No special documentation is required beyond a standard application, and the accounts are available for both live and demo trading.
